Formula 1: Ted Kravitz has paid a touching tribute to Daniel Ricciardo as reports circulate he's set to be replaced by Liam Lawson.

Success in Formula 1 is the meeting of potential and circumstance. The best driver in the world can’t win in the slowest car on the grid, and even a great car can be made to look ordinary by a driver of a lesser calibre.

His breakout year was undeniably 2014. Not only was he the only non-Mercedes driver to win a race — and he won three — but he comfortably accounted for his teammate, reigning four-time champion Sebastian Vettel.It was during his stint at Milton Keynes that he forged his fearsome, intimidating on-track style as a relentless and creative overtaking machine.

Ricciardo’s run at Red Bull Racing was central to his reputation, but the timing of his arrival there ultimately short-changed him. The Australian collected a couple of unlikely and hard-earnt podiums — the team’s first since it returned to the sport in 2016 — and obliterated teammate Esteban Ocon, almost doubling the Frenchman’s points to finish fifth in the standings, equal to or better than three of his five title finishes at Red Bull Racing.The results of previous years are included below for context.

He was right, but he was wrong about the timing, with Woking still several years away from coming good.McLaren dropped to fourth and then fifth in the standings during Ricciardo’s ill-fated two-year stint as it grappled with a car wracked by peculiar handling requirements that proved insurmountable for the Australian.

By the middle of the year, with Ricciardo’s still stubbornly off the pace, the trigger was pulled to dump the older Australian with a year still to run on his deal.Not only was Ricciardo without a drive for 2023, but halfway through that season McLaren finally turned around its years-long slump. Ricciardo’s races last year were generally inconclusive, but he had the handicap of skipping five grands prix with a broken hand sustained in just the third race of his comeback. His highs — notably a strong weekend in Mexico — were enough to justify keeping him in 2024 to see what he could do with a clean swing at it.Ricciardo started his critical make-or-break season poorly.

Red Bull Racing changed its mind, deciding instead to double down on Pérez, at least for the following four races, ending with this weekend’s Singapore Grand Prix.
